Plan B

So, we are onto Plan B. Which is a series of surgeries. To my relief I finally have a date and time for the first of the two surgeries. The fist surgery will be on September 25th at 1pm. This surgery will involve putting a nail/wire wrapped in cement (the kind used in hip replacements) that is then impregnated w/antibiotics. This nail will go through the main shaft of the bone, Medullary cavity to be exact, so that the antibiotics will leach out from the center killing off any thing and every thing that is not healthy to the bone. I am thrilled to report that I get to go off all anti-biotic medication for 5 days prior to surgery. This is in hopes I "grow" something and when they take cultures from the bone the doctors will know exactly what to hit it with. In any case I am very excited to be off the "leash" of the anti-biotics. The bummer of the deal is that the nail is not made to be weight bearing so I will be off my right leg for three whole weeks. On the up side is that I will not be lugging all the weight of the Taylor-Spacial-Frame. It will be removed an an Izzie frame will be holding my leg in line--a couple of half pins at my knee and ankle with a bar connecting the two.

The second of the two surgeries is a lot simpler. It is very basic infact, just taking all the hardware put in the 1st surgery and then putting a rod/nail that is permanet. The permanet device will actually be quite similar to the original rod/nail put into me in Mexico--can you get more ironic than that?
